Lord Woo Fak Fak is a large, green anglerfish and the boss of Jolly Roger's Lagoon in Banjo-Tooie. He is subtitled as the "Self-Important Anglerfish".

Lord Woo Fak Fak has yellow eyes with red pupils, sharp teeth, and boils all over his face. A Jiggy is inside of his anger bulb, and is used as his light source.

Game appearances

Banjo-Tooie

In Banjo-Tooie, Banjo and Kazooie encounter Lord Woo Fak Fak in Davy Jones' Locker. There, they notice the Jiggy in his angler bulb and approach it. Lord Woo Fak Fak wakes up and shouts at the duo, asking who they are. Banjo lies that they came to deliver his mail, but Lord Woo Fak Fak immediately figures out that they came to steal his Jiggy. Kazooie agrees to "something like that", and the battle starts.

The battle starts with Lord Woo Fak Fak having his eyes closed. To attack, Banjo and Kazooie must shoot at Lord Woo Fak Fak's flashing boil using either a Grenade Egg or a submarine torpedo. Lord Woo Fak Fak attacks by firing electric orbs from his angler. Once the duo hit all six boils, Lord Woo Fak Fak condemns them and opens his eyes, starting the second phase of the battle. Here, Banjo and Kazooie must shoot at Lord Woo Fak Fak's eyes, each requiring three hits. Lord Woo Fak Fak instead starts firing bubble traps, which have a more accurate aim. When both eyes are hit three times, Lord Woo Fak Fak is defeated, causing him to turn upside down and leave behind his Jiggy.

After the battle, if Banjo and Kazooie shoot at Lord Woo Fak Fak, he tells them to stop. In one quote, he claims to be dead (despite talking in that moment) and says that he has no more Jiggies.

Banjo-Kazooie: Nuts & Bolts

In Banjo-Kazooie: Nuts & Bolts, there is a photograph of Lord Woo Fak Fak in Banjoland. Additionally, in Showdown Town, there is an abandoned building near the pier called "The Fak Fak".

Trivia

  • Lord Woo Fak Fak's name was inspired by Paul Machacek, an engineer at Rare who developed a reputation around at work for his colourful language. When encountering problems during development of the games, he would frequently swear before finally exclaiming "Woo!" when the problem was solved.[1]
  • According to King Jingaling, he and Lord Woo Fak Fak often go fishing together, but he is not supposed to tell anyone.
  • If Banjo touches Lord Woo Fak Fak during the battle, Banjo reacts as if he has taken damage, but he does not actually lose any health.
